Why SCARA Robot ABB Matters

SCARA robots (Selective Compliance Assembly Robot Arms) are specifically designed for high-speed assembly and handling tasks, offering exceptional flexibility, precision, and repeatability. Their unique arm configuration, consisting of two parallel rotating arms and a vertical Z-axis, enables precise movement in a horizontal plane, making them ideal for applications such as:

  • Assembly: Component insertion, fastening, and packaging
  • Handling: Pick-and-place, palletizing, and material transfer
  • Inspection: Visual inspection, measurement, and quality control

Challenges and Limitations

While SCARA robots offer numerous benefits, it's essential to be aware of potential challenges and limitations:

  • Limited Vertical Reach: SCARA robots have a limited vertical range of motion, which may not be suitable for applications requiring significant height variation.
  • Payload-Speed Trade-off: Higher payload capacities may compromise speed and precision. Careful consideration is required to balance these factors.
  • Complex Programming: Programming SCARA robots for complex tasks can be time-consuming and require specialized expertise.
